Frequently Asked Questions

How can I find a local optometrist in or near Thayer, KS?

In Thayer itself, options may be limited as it's a small town. Your best approach is to search for optometrists in nearby larger communities like Chanute, Iola, or Yates Center, which are within a reasonable driving distance. You can use online directories, ask for recommendations from your primary care provider at the Thayer Clinic, or check with local pharmacies. Many residents of Thayer also find eye care services in Independence or Parsons, which offer more comprehensive optical centers.

What should I look for when choosing an optometrist serving the Thayer, KS area?

Given Thayer's rural location, prioritize optometrists who understand the needs of a smaller community. Look for practices in neighboring towns that offer flexible scheduling to accommodate travel. Check if they provide comprehensive eye exams, manage common conditions like dry eye (which can be prevalent in Kansas's climate), and have a good selection of frames. It's also helpful to choose an optometrist who has established relationships with specialists in larger cities like Wichita or Kansas City, should a referral be necessary.

Do optometrists near Thayer, KS accept my vision or medical insurance?

Most optometry practices in the surrounding counties (Neosho, Allen, Woodson) accept a range of vision and medical insurance plans. It's crucial to call ahead to verify. When contacting an office in Chanute or Iola, specifically ask if they are in-network with providers common in rural Kansas, such as Blue Cross Blue Shield of Kansas, Medicare, and VSP. Be prepared to provide your insurance details over the phone to confirm coverage and any co-pays specific to eye exams or materials.

What eye care services are typically available from optometrists in this region of Kansas?

Optometrists serving the Thayer area typically offer comprehensive eye exams for all ages, prescriptions for glasses and contact lenses, and diagnosis/managing of eye diseases like glaucoma, cataracts, and diabetic retinopathy. Given the agricultural setting, many practices are adept at treating eye injuries or irritations from dust and pollen. Some may also provide pre- and post-operative care for cataract surgery, though the surgeries themselves would be performed at a surgical center in a larger city.

How far in advance should I schedule an eye exam with an optometrist near Thayer, KS?

For routine eye exams, scheduling 2-4 weeks in advance is generally advisable for optometrists in the nearby towns. Appointments can book up quickly, especially for popular times like Saturdays or after school hours. If you have an urgent concern (like a sudden change in vision or an injury), be sure to explain the situation when you call, as many practices will work to fit you in for an emergency visit. Planning ahead is key due to the potential travel required from Thayer to the optometrist's office.
